Streamlining the Recommendation Letter Writing Process

Writing a letter of recommendation requires careful thought and consideration. It often involves highlighting the
strengths, achievements, and character of the individual being recommended. AI can streamline this process by
analyzing data and generating relevant content based on predefined templates and algorithms. By automating the
initial drafting stage, AI can assist in creating a comprehensive and well-structured recommendation letter.

Pros and Cons of AI-Generated Letters of Recommendation

Undoubtedly, the advent of AI-generated letters of recommendation brings both advantages and disadvantages. Assessing these pros and cons will allow us to form a well-rounded perspective on the usage of AI in this context. The table below presents some compelling insights into this matter.

Pros Cons
Efficiency: AI can produce letters quickly, saving time for those tasked with writing them manually. Lack of Personal Touch: AI-generated letters may lack the personalized touch and familiarity present in human-written recommendations.
Objective Assessment: AI follows uniform criteria when evaluating candidates’ skills, ensuring fairness and removing potential bias. Subjectivity Absence: AI lacks the human ability to consider intangible qualities or unique circumstances that could positively impact the candidate.
Vocabulary Richness: AI can utilize an extensive vocabulary to express the strengths of the recommended individual. Imperfections in Language: Occasionally, AI may produce grammatical errors or sentences with unintended meanings, jeopardizing the overall quality of the recommendation.

Comparison of AI-Generated and Human-Authored Letters

Let’s delve into a comprehensive comparison between letters of recommendation generated by AI and those crafted by humans. Examining the distinct characteristics of both can help establish the strengths and weaknesses of each approach. The following table provides intriguing insights into this contrast.

Criteria AI-Generated Letters Human-Authored Letters
Speed of Generation Minimal time required to compose a letter. Time-consuming due to manual efforts.
Personalization May lack a sense of personal connection. Can reflect deep familiarity with the candidate.
Adaptability AI can learn from user feedback to refine future recommendations. Human writers can adapt to specific needs and context.
Language Quality AI can generate well-structured and coherent letters. Humans can generally ensure impeccable language usage.
